For the fiscal 2014 annual goodwill impairment testing, Autodesk had four reporting units: Platform Solutions and
Emerging Business (“PSEB”), Manufacturing ("MFG"), Architecture, Engineering and Construction ("AEC") and Media and
Entertainment ("M&E"). For each of four reporting units, Autodesk did not utilize the optional assessment but rather
performed the quantitative two-step impairment test. In performing the quantitative two-step test, Autodesk used a discounted
cash flow model which included assumptions regarding projected cash flows. Based on this testing, Autodesk determined that
the fair value was substantially in excess of the carrying value for each of the four reporting units and that there was no
impairment of goodwill during the year ended January 31, 2014. In addition, Autodesk did not recognize any goodwill
impairment losses in fiscal 2013 or 2012.
